即使网页允许爬取,也要对网站持尊重态度,不要做任何破坏网页的行为。请遵循网络爬虫排除协议中概述的规则,在非高峰时段进行爬取,限制来自一个IP地址的请求数,并在请求之间设置延迟值。...选择一个可靠的代理服务提供商,并根据您的任务在数据中心代理和住宅代理之间进行选择。 在设备和目标网站之间使用中介可以减少IP地址被封的风险,确保匿名,并允许您访问您所在地区不可用的网站。...如果您从同一IP地址发送太多请求,目标网站将很快把您标识为威胁并封锁您的IP地址。代理轮换使您看起来像许多不同的网络用户,减少了被封锁IP的概率。...正确设置指纹 反抓取机制变得越来越复杂,一些网站使用传输控制协议(TCP)或IP指纹来检测僵尸程序。 抓取网页时,TCP会留下各种参数。这些参数由最终用户的操作系统或设备设置。...A:IP地址速率限制意味着在特定时间网站上可执行的操作数有限。为避免请求受到限制,请尊重网站并降低抓取速度。
在 OAuth 出现之前,网站会提示您直接在表单中输入用户名和密码,然后他们会以您的身份登录到您的数据(例如您的 Gmail 帐户)。这通常称为密码反模式....它们的行为与您的传统 Web 应用程序不同,因为它们对 API 进行 AJAX(后台 HTTP 调用)。手机也进行 API 调用,电视、游戏机和物联网设备也是如此。...它们不在桌面上运行或通过应用程序商店分发。人们无法对它们进行逆向工程并获得密钥。它们在最终用户无法访问的受保护区域中运行。 公共客户端是浏览器、移动应用程序和物联网设备。...当然,您需要对应用程序进行身份验证,因此如果您未对资源服务器进行身份验证,它会要求您登录。如果您已经有一个缓存的会话 cookie,您只会看到同意对话框。查看同意对话框并同意。...当人们问您是否支持 OAuth 时,您必须澄清他们的要求。他们是在问您是否支持所有六个流程,还是只支持主要流程?所有不同的流程之间都有很多可用的粒度。 安全与企业 OAuth 的应用范围很广。
在 OAuth 出现之前,网站会提示您直接在表单中输入用户名和密码,然后他们会以您的身份登录到您的数据(例如您的 Gmail 帐户)。这通常称为密码反模式....它们的行为与您的传统 Web 应用程序不同,因为它们对 API 进行 AJAX(后台 HTTP 调用)。手机也进行 API 调用,电视、游戏机和物联网设备也是如此。...人们无法对它们进行逆向工程并获得密钥。它们在最终用户无法访问的受保护区域中运行。 公共客户端是浏览器、移动应用程序和物联网设备。 客户端注册也是 OAuth 的一个关键组成部分。...当然,您需要对应用程序进行身份验证,因此如果您未对资源服务器进行身份验证,它会要求您登录。如果您已经有一个缓存的会话 cookie,您只会看到同意对话框。查看同意对话框并同意。...当人们问您是否支持 OAuth 时,您必须澄清他们的要求。他们是在问您是否支持所有六个流程,还是只支持主要流程?所有不同的流程之间都有很多可用的粒度。 安全与企业 OAuth 的应用范围很广。
允许这些通常是安全的(拒绝这些数据包不会隐藏您的服务器。有很多其他方法可以让用户查明您的主机是否已启动),但您可以阻止它们或限制您响应的源地址你想。...类型13 - 时间戳请求:客户端可以使用这些数据包来收集延迟信息。它们可用于某些操作系统指纹识别技术,因此如果您愿意或限制它们响应的地址范围,请阻止它们。...例如,它可以查看源地址,源端口,目标地址,目标端口或这四个值的任意组合来散列每个条目。它可以通过接收的数据包或字节来限制。基本上,这提供了灵活的每客户端或每服务速率限制。...recent扩展动态地将客户端IP地址对当规则匹配现有列表列表或检查。这允许您在复杂模式的许多不同规则之间传播限制逻辑。...它能够像其他限制器一样指定命中计数和时间范围,但如果看到额外的流量,还可以重置时间范围,有效地迫使客户端在限制时停止所有流量。 选择使用哪种速率限制扩展取决于您希望执行的确切策略。
摘要 本文将讨论如何使用Java编程语言实现限制特定IP地址访问网页的功能。IP地址限制是一种常见的安全措施,用于限制只有特定IP地址的用户才能访问敏感页面或资源。...有时候,您可能需要限制对某些页面或资源的访问,以确保只有授权的用户才能获取这些敏感信息。IP地址限制是一种简单且有效的方法,允许您基于用户的IP地址来控制他们是否可以访问特定页面。...实现方式 要实现IP地址限制功能,您可以按照以下步骤进行操作: 获取客户端IP地址: 在Java Web应用程序中,您可以使用HttpServletRequest对象获取用户的IP地址。...结论 通过实现IP地址限制功能,您可以有效地加强您的Web应用程序的安全性。这种方法特别适用于需要限制对敏感信息的访问的情况。...本文介绍了实现IP地址限制的一般步骤,包括获取客户端IP地址、定义允许访问的IP地址列表、验证IP地址和实现过滤器或拦截器。
3、企业间谍活动一些公司雇佣黑客从竞争对手那里窃取机密信息(业务/用户数据、商业秘密、定价信息等),他们还利用网站黑客攻击目标网站,他们可能会泄露机密信息或使网站无法访问,从而损害竞争对手的声誉。...4、黑客行动主义在某些情况下,黑客并非受金钱驱使。他们只是想表达一个观点——社会、经济、政治、宗教或伦理,他们利用网站篡改、勒索软件、DDoS攻击、泄露机密信息等手段。...黑客还花费大量时间和精力来挖掘业务逻辑缺陷,例如安全设计缺陷、交易和工作流中的业务逻辑执行等,以从客户端入侵网站。5、寻找API漏洞今天大多数网站都使用API与后端系统进行通信。...获取托管在特定IP地址的Web服务器列表很容易,只需找到要利用的漏洞即可,如果您的网站在开发阶段就没有得到保护,风险会进一步增加。...在网络、服务器和应用层等不同级别引入速率限制,以限制来自单个源或 IP 地址的请求或连接的数量。这有助于防止在 DDoS 攻击期间使您的资源不堪重负。
要理解这一点,我们需要先了解 TCP 握手的一个重要目的:在传输任何高层数据之前,让客户端验证服务器是否确实在指定的 IP 地址上可用。...更重要的是,这让服务器能够在发送数据前验证客户端的身份和位置是否真实。如果您还记得我们在第 1 部分中介绍的 4 元组连接定义,就会知道客户端主要是通过 IP 地址来识别的。...服务器可以验证 0-RTT 请求是否来自之前建立过有效连接的 IP 地址。然而,这种方法仅在客户端保持在同一网络时有效(这也限制了 QUIC 的连接迁移功能)。...如果您的网站或应用主要用于移动场景(比如Uber或Google Maps),相比于主要在办公环境下使用的情况,您能获得更多收益。...同样,如果您的应用主要用于实时交互(如视频聊天、协作编辑或游戏),相比新闻网站,在网络切换时您能获得更显著的性能改善。 队头阻塞消除 # 第四个性能特性是消除队头(HoL)阻塞问题。
Google作为您的数据处理器,他们有义务遵守欧盟GDPR。根据Google自己的隐私合规网站,他们“正在努力为欧盟的通用数据保护条例做准备。”...2启用IP匿名 根据GDPR,IP地址被视为PII。即使IP地址(默认情况下)从未在报告中公开过,Google也使用它来提供地址位置数据。...这一变化的结果是在技术上可行的情况下,Google将立即通过删除IP地址的最后八位字节(您的IP变成123.123.123.0——最后一个部分/八位字节被替换为‘0’)匿名化IP地址。...5 建立选择加入/退出功能 对每家公司来说,一个重要的问题是,他们是否真的需要得到用户对被追踪数据的明确同意。毕竟,这可能需要大量的工作,而且绝对会影响Google Analytics中的用户参与。...如果您正在使用Google Analytics数据来收集用户ID/哈希PII,或者帮助进行行为分析,或者您正在使用其他广告技术,那么您将需要建立一个可供选择的同意机制以及在任何时候允许用户选择退出的功能
或者,如果您使用您的网站开展业务,您可能会存储有关您的员工或即将推出的产品的详细信息。这些东西中的任何一个都可以证明对黑客很有价值。...9、展示能力很多引人注目的网络攻击都是出于其他原因而进行的,肇事者想知道他们是否有能力将其成功占有。换句话说,黑客可能会瞄准您的网站,看看他们是否可以用自己的实力而破解防御。吹牛是另一个流行的动机。...如果您的网站赚钱而又无法访问时,您会希望它得到修复。如果黑客知道这一点,他们可以控制您的网站并要求付款以换取回报。...对response报文进行处理,对响应内容和响应进行识别和过滤,根据需要设置数据防泄漏规则,保护网站数据安全。可以设置源IP或者特点接口访问速率,对超过速率的访问进行排队处理,减缓服务器压力。...限制连接数:网站可以设置最大连接数限制,以防止单个IP地址或用户同时建立过多的连接。这可以防止攻击者使用大量连接来消耗服务器资源。DDoS防护服务:德迅云安全公司提供专门的DDoS防护服务。
人们用SSL将客户端和服务器之间的数据加密并进行认证,以此来保护重要的数据。大家在上网时都可以看到,Web浏览器的网址显示为“https:”的形式,前面有一把上锁的标记。...在未安装SSL证书时,用户和服务器之间的信息传输是明文的,容易被外界截取,而且对最终用户来说,他们在浏览服务器时,并不知道这个服务器、网页是否真的存在,且如果存在,信息是否真实可信。...但是这也是他们的弊端,DV SSL证书仅适合于个人网站或非电子商务网站,由于此类只验证域名所有权的低端SSL证书不需要验证已经被国外各种欺诈网站滥用。...例如WEB网站建设,IP地址通常采取的是明文HTTP传输协议,这非常不安全,会导致传输协议过程中的数据泄露或者劫持。假如我们的IP地址绑定了SSL证书,此IP地址就会被加密。...所以给证书绑定IP地址可以遏制SSL证书的滥用,同时也相当于给IP地址装上了一层保护伞。不知道大家在使用的时候SSL证书是,是否遇到过此SSL信息不受网站信任的提示,这时需要我们进行信任授权。
此后,请求将发送到网站,因为发送了 HTTP_VIA 标头,所以网站将知道已使用代理,但不会看到您的 IP 地址。...以下是匿名代理的主要用途: 逃避审查并访问本地和受限制的 Web 资源: 在浏览器上忘记隐身模式;如果您访问的网站可以访问您的 IP 地址,那您就是不匿名的。...通过您的 IP 地址,他们可以检测到您的位置(虽然不是绝对的)。安全机构可以使用您的 IP 地址以及其他信息来跟踪您。 有了您的 IP 地址,您的政府或办公室就可以在线监控您的活动。...网站可以使用您的 IP 地址来拒绝您访问其他地方的本地内容。因为代理可以隐藏您的 IP 地址,它可以帮助您规避所有这些。 网页爬取和抓取: 大多数网站都有操作限制。...品牌保护: 不知名的人或公司在网上做什么,不会引起别人的注意。如果您以知名公司的身份进行尝试,它可能会引起很多关注,这可能会损害您的品牌形象。
文章前言 浏览网络时,几乎可以肯定您会遇到一些使您可以使用社交媒体帐户登录的网站,该功能很可能是使用流行的OAuth 2.0框架构建的,OAuth 2.0对于攻击者来说非常有趣,因为它非常常见,而且天生就容易出现实现错误...像往常一样,我们提供了一系列存在漏洞的网站,称为"实验室",以便您可以在实践中看到这些漏洞,并将所学的利用这些漏洞的知识进行测试,如果您想直接进入实验室,可以从我们的实验室索引页面访问完整列表。...OAuth 2.0验证识别 识别应用程序是否使用OAuth身份验证相对简单,如果看到从其他网站使用您的帐户登录的选项,则强烈表明正在使用OAuth。...到了这个阶段,您应该对URI的哪些部分可以进行篡改有了比较好的了解,现在的关键是使用这些知识来尝试访问客户端应用程序本身中更广泛的攻击面,换句话说,尝试确定是否可以将redirect_uri参数更改为指向白名单域上的任何其他页面...一些提供OAuth服务的网站允许用户注册帐户,而不必验证他们的所有详细信息,在某些情况下还包括他们的电子邮件地址,攻击者可以通过使用与目标用户相同的详细信息(例如已知的电子邮件地址)向OAuth提供程序注册帐户来利用此漏洞
我的网站何时会出现在搜索中? 重复内容问题 网址结构问题 总结 首先,Google 蜘蛛寻找新的页面。然后,Google 对这些页面进行索引,以了解它们的内容,并根据检索到的数据对它们进行排名。...注意:链接应该遵循,让Googlebot 跟随他们。虽然谷歌最近表示,没有跟随链接也可以用作爬行和索引的提示,我们仍然建议使用dofollow。只是为了确保爬行者确实看到页面。...理想情况下,网站的任何页面应在 3 次点击内到达。更大的点击深度会减慢爬行速度,并且几乎不会使用户体验受益。 您可以使用Web 网站审核员检查您的网站是否与点击深度有关。...一些 CMS 甚至会自动生成站点图、更新它并将其发送到 Google,使您的 SEO 流程更快、更轻松。如果您的网站是新的或大的(有超过500个网址),请考虑提交网站图。...Noindex标签、robots元标签和X-Robots标签是用于限制爬行者爬行和索引页面的标签。Noindex标签限制所有类型的爬行器对页面进行索引。
以下是三个身份及其用途的摘要: 主机名: 一个对用户和管理员友好的名称,为他们提供了一种简单的方法来识别节点。 IP 地址: 路由器和网络配置工具用来识别系统的逻辑地址。...ip addr 命令(或尝试 hostname -I 命令)确认 IP 地址是否正确。...从最终用户的角度来看,这意味着他们的计算机正在自行配置以进行网络连接。无论是在家庭环境还是企业网络中,您都可能将 Linux 系统保留为 DHCP 客户端。...想象一下,如果您必须通过其特定的 IP 地址来跟踪所有您喜欢的互联网网站! 名称解析是指存储和使用有关哪些主机名与哪些 IP 地址相关的信息。 域名系统 (DNS) 提供名称解析。...由于它不知道如何处理此名称,因此它会询问 DNS 服务器,DNS 服务器会以相应的 IP 地址进行响应。
让我们对这些选项进行比较,并讨论不同时机应该使用哪种产品。...这可能会限制您在可以正确安装CA的组织或技术精通用户组中进行内部使用。较大的IT部门通常有办法自动将CA部署到用户,使这个解决方案对他们更具吸引力。...与自签名证书(每个证书必须手动标记为受信任证书)不同,您只需安装一次私有CA。然后,从该CA颁发的所有证书都将继承该信任。 一个缺点是运行CA会产生一些开销,需要知道如何以安全的方式进行设置和维护。...如果适当的撤销对您的使用很重要,您还需要为证书吊销列表或OCSP响应者维护HTTP服务器。 结论 我们已经回顾了一些获取或创建SSL证书的不同选项。...如果你有域名,保护你网站的最简单方法是使用腾讯云SSL证书服务,它提供免费的可信证书。腾讯云SSL证书安装操作指南进行设置。
免费 SSL 证书包含EdgeOne 会自动为您接入的网站申请并续期 SSL 证书,让您的网站轻松实现 HTTPS 加密,地址栏显示安全小锁。...这个 CNAME 地址,就是 EdgeOne 为您的网站在全球部署的“前置仓”的总入口。接下来,我们需要去您的域名注册商那里,告诉他们:“以后所有访问我网站的请求,都请先送到这个新地址来。”...(可选)根域名解析:如果您希望用户直接访问 yourdomain.com(不带www)也能加速,您需要检查您的域名注册商是否支持根域名的 CNAME 解析。...速率限制:路径:左侧菜单 -> 安全防护 -> 速率限制做什么:防止恶意程序高频率地访问您的网站特定页面(例如登录接口),这常被称为 CC 攻击。...通过本文的详细介绍,相信您已经对如何使用 EdgeOne 有了全面的了解。它为您提供了一个零成本、零风险的机会,让您的网站或应用在性能和安全上实现质的飞跃。现在,就去亲自体验一下吧!
说明:如果您当前使用的是腾讯云内容分发网络 CDN,建议升级至 EdgeOne,并在 EdgeOne 上配置相应的防护策略。...一旦出现告警,立刻根据 排查措施 排查实时请求是否正常,并按 应对措施 进行相应处理。说明:用量封顶配置生效存在一定延迟(10分钟左右),期间产生的消耗会正常计费。...URLs:客户端请求的具体资源路径。资源类型:客户端请求的资源类型,例如:“.png”“.json”等。客户端 IP 地址:客户端请求的具体来源 IP 地址。...场景五:设置 CC 攻击单 IP 高频访问限制(临时高防)平台托管的速率限制规则 通过速率基线学习、头部特征统计分析和客户端 IP 情报等方式识别 CC 攻击,并进行处置。...在网站遭受盗刷攻击时,域名的带宽将显著增加。为了应对这种情况,推荐您使用 EdgeOne Web 防护功能的速率限制,根据正常业务水位设定阈值,配置限速策略,或通过 实时日志 监控和调整策略。
A 代理服务器,即代理,是您与互联网之间的媒介。当您使用代理服务器时,您的请求首先通过代理服务器(更改您的IP地址)运行,然后才连接到网站。 代理类型 代理有许多不同的类型。...它是附加到物理位置的真实IP地址,因此允许用户在进行网页抓取时模仿自然浏览行为,从而减少了被目标网站阻止的概率,并且在住宅代理后面隐藏真实IP地址具有更高的安全性。...更重要的是,当真实IP地址无权访问某些受地理限制的内容时,绑定到特定位置的代理可以解锁此特定信息。...同时,许多企业会使用代理来执行他们的日常运营,例如使用广告验证来匿名检查广告商的登录页面,旅行票价聚合商则通过使用代理来爬取航班价格,而无需担心IP封锁或禁令。...您是否需要代理服务器? 这主要取决于您计划做什么。如果您只是想要隐藏您的IP地址,那么使用虚拟专用网络就绰绰有余了。但如果您想要收集大量数据,那么代理服务器可能更适合您。
也就是说,大多数人都遵循相同的基本结构:客户端,服务器和数据库。 客户端 客户端是用户与之交互的。 因此,“客户端”代码对用户实际看到的大部分内容负责。...例如,如果您正在构建社交媒体网站,则会使用数据库来存储有关用户,帖子和评论的信息。...由于您无法广播所有服务器实例的IP地址,因此您将创建虚拟IP地址,这是您向客户公开广播的地址。此虚拟IP地址指向您的负载平衡器。因此,当您的站点有DNS查找时,它将指向负载均衡器。...工作很好,对吧? ...但是,只要复制一堆服务器,仍然会导致问题,因为您的应用程序不断增长。当您为应用程序添加更多功能时,您必须保证服务器数量的增长。...内容分发网络 以上所有功能都适用于扩展,但您的应用程序仍然集中在一个位置。 当您的用户从国家的其他地方(或世界的另一边)访问您的网站时,由于客户端和服务器之间的距离增加,可能会需要更长的加载时间。
它允许客户端基于授权服务器执行的身份验证来验证最终用户的身份,以及以可互操作和类似REST的方式获取关于最终用户的基本配置文件信息。...in User.Claims) { @claim.Type @claim.Value } 如果您现在使用浏览器访问...再次,Scopes代表您想要保护的客户端希望访问的内容。 与OAuth相反,OIDC中的范围不代表API,而是代表用户ID,姓名或电子邮件地址等身份信息。...你应该看到重定向到IdentityServer的登录页面。 成功登录后,用户将看到同意画面。 在这里,用户可以决定是否要将他的身份信息发布到客户端应用程序。...这个scope还包括像名字或网站这样的声明。